My Students

Adora Svitak once said, "By bringing current events into the class and daily discussion, maybe we won't need to wait for our grandchildren's questions to remind us we should have paid more attention to current events." Students at my school need to read engaging magazines to know current events.

Students at my school are curious, eager to learn, and appreciative of all that we have to teach them.

Students at my school make the best of the cards that they were dealt to them and look for ways to build their path to a better future through their own education. Most come from low income families, have experienced trauma in their short lives, and all receive free breakfast and lunch at school. Our school is a safe place where students can come to learn, be nurtured, be challenged, and exposed to the arts.

My Project

We have very little materials available to us to teach social studies meaningfully and effectively. The fourth and fifth grade teachers at my school (5 total teachers) are looking to enhance our existing curricula and use "TIME for Kids" to teach students about what is going on in the world around them. We find that we often get bogged down teaching only the standards and know that this isn't enough for our students. We would like the opportunity to teach students both their grade level standards and current events which would make for a comprehensive and exciting curriculum for students.

Donations to this project will improve five different classrooms by allowing students access to high interest reading materials on current events.

Students will be able to increase their knowledge of the world around them, reading abilities, and TIME For Kids will become a common theme students can talk about amongst grade levels.
